Kathy Teresa (May) Martin, 63, a resident of Ozark, died Friday, June 5, 2015 at Dale Medical Center.

Funeral services will be held 11:00 a.m. Saturday, June 13, 2015 at Fuqua-Bankston Funeral Home Chapel with Brother Charles Goldsmith officiating. Burial arrangements will be announced at a later time. The family will receive friends at the funeral home one hour prior to the service time.

Mrs. Martin was born November 3, 1951 in Laurel, Ms. to Robert and Jacquelyn May. She was a loving wife, mother, grandmother, great grandmother and sister. Kathy loved her family and friends. She was a lifelong animal lover. She was proud of her Indian heritage, was an avid shopper, and enjoyed cruising with the sunroof open listening to her favorite music. She will be loved and missed by all who knew her.

She is survived by her husband, James Martin of Ozark; a daughter, Debbie Ashcraft; two sons, John Miller (Rebecca) and Kenneth Martin; a sister, Lisa May; a brother, Steve May (Heidi); seven grandchildren, Almee Miller, Ashley Miller, Rowyne Ashcraft, Joshua Ashcraft, Jacob Miller, Benjamin Saxon and Zoie Miller; two great grandchildren, Pheanyx Miller and Jagger Hughes, and a lifelong friend, Sheila Walker.
